View Issue Details

IDProjectCategoryView StatusLast Update
0005936Spring engineGeneralpublic2018-03-25 22:35
ReporterGoogle_Frog Assigned ToKloot  
PrioritynormalSeveritymajorReproducibilityrandom
Status resolvedResolutionreopened 
Product Version104.0 +git 
Fixed in Version104.0 +git 
Summary0005936: Desyncs at frame 300
DescriptionThere have been a few recent reports of early desyncs. In the first report multiple games seem to desync. In the second report leaving and rejoining appears to fix the problem.

104.0.1-313-g3d4f772 maintenance
Battle: http://zero-k.info/Battles/Detail/491737
https://github.com/ZeroK-RTS/CrashReports/issues/3866
https://github.com/ZeroK-RTS/CrashReports/issues/3867

104.0.1-311-g5adac5b maintenance
Battle: http://zero-k.info/Battles/Detail/491578
https://github.com/ZeroK-RTS/CrashReports/issues/3849
https://github.com/ZeroK-RTS/CrashReports/issues/3850
https://github.com/ZeroK-RTS/CrashReports/issues/3851
https://github.com/ZeroK-RTS/CrashReports/issues/3852
https://github.com/ZeroK-RTS/CrashReports/issues/3853
https://github.com/ZeroK-RTS/CrashReports/issues/3854
TagsNo tags attached.
Checked infolog.txt for Errors

Activities

Google_Frog

2018-03-20 07:45

reporter   ~0018922

Another infolog for the first game: https://github.com/ZeroK-RTS/CrashReports/issues/3868

Kloot

2018-03-20 10:50

developer   ~0018923

First game features AI's and QTPFS.

The second might be more interesting.

Kloot

2018-03-20 17:36

developer   ~0018924

Fix 35484d00aded3e55da1b74825062fc03092c14e9 committed to develop branch: fix 0005936, repo: spring changeset id: 9849

Kloot

2018-03-20 17:37

developer   ~0018925

Fix 941b4e54dc59a87b938d0434c136b37f1dba57dc committed to maintenance branch: fix 0005936, repo: spring changeset id: 9853

Google_Frog

2018-03-24 09:24

reporter   ~0018929

Here is the same thing with 104.0.1-325-g9ad8116 maintenance:
https://github.com/ZeroK-RTS/CrashReports/issues/3888
http://zero-k.info/Battles/Detail/492139

hokomoko

2018-03-24 10:29

developer   ~0018930

They're using QTPFS

Google_Frog

2018-03-24 15:30

reporter   ~0018931

Oh. Time to nuke that modoption I guess.

Kloot

2018-03-24 16:09

developer   ~0018932

the "clear path cache" menu option in ZK should probably be extended to QTPFS.

Kloot

2018-03-25 22:35

developer   ~0018941

can't produce a desync locally with QTPFS enabled, so I assume 491737 and 492139 were cache invalidation issues.

Issue History

Date Modified Username Field Change
2018-03-20 06:06 Google_Frog New Issue
2018-03-20 07:45 Google_Frog Note Added: 0018922
2018-03-20 10:50 Kloot Note Added: 0018923
2018-03-20 17:36 Kloot Changeset attached => spring develop 35484d00
2018-03-20 17:36 Kloot Note Added: 0018924
2018-03-20 17:36 Kloot Assigned To => Kloot
2018-03-20 17:36 Kloot Status new => resolved
2018-03-20 17:36 Kloot Resolution open => fixed
2018-03-20 17:37 Kloot Changeset attached => spring maintenance 941b4e54
2018-03-20 17:37 Kloot Note Added: 0018925
2018-03-24 09:24 Google_Frog Status resolved => feedback
2018-03-24 09:24 Google_Frog Resolution fixed => reopened
2018-03-24 09:24 Google_Frog Note Added: 0018929
2018-03-24 10:29 hokomoko Note Added: 0018930
2018-03-24 15:30 Google_Frog Note Added: 0018931
2018-03-24 15:30 Google_Frog Status feedback => assigned
2018-03-24 16:09 Kloot Note Added: 0018932
2018-03-24 16:09 Kloot Assigned To Kloot =>
2018-03-24 16:09 Kloot Status assigned => new
2018-03-25 22:35 Kloot Assigned To => Kloot
2018-03-25 22:35 Kloot Status new => resolved
2018-03-25 22:35 Kloot Fixed in Version => 104.0 +git
2018-03-25 22:35 Kloot Note Added: 0018941